Job summary
A prominent nonprofit organization is seeking an Oregon Intern to support grassroots campaigns in Portland. This role involves recruiting volunteers, developing campaign plans, and representing the organization at events. The ideal candidate should have organizing or advocacy experience, be familiar with Oregon politics, and possess strong communication and organizational skills. This internship lasts 9 weeks at $18/hour, with a commitment of 29 hours per week.
Qualifications
Organizing or advocacy experience, either paid or volunteer.
Familiarity with Oregon politics and communities.
Excellent writing and verbal communication skills.
Excellent time management and organizational skills.
Responsibilities
Recruit volunteers and allies for campaigns.
Develop campaign plans with staff.
Organize strategic campaign tactics.
Develop leadership in volunteers and organizations.
Represent Food & Water Watch at events.
Participate in member recruitment and fundraising.
